As companies pursue new strategies for electrification, engineers skilled in converting traditional systems to efficient, grid-powered models are in high demand. Ideal for engineers, scientists, as well as anyone interested in electrified systems, this course offers a comprehensive overview of electrification and the critical role of modeling and simulation in designing effective electrified systems. Through engaging modules, you’ll explore the challenges of designing and simulating electrified systems across diverse applications and discover how MATLAB, Simulink, and Simscape can make modeling complex systems easier. Real-world case studies, such as electric vehicle simulations and integrating solar panels into the grid, provide practical insights into the applications of these technologies.
